The Ogulu family celebrated as Nissi Ogulu, Afrobeat artist and sister of Grammy winner Burna Boy, received the Forbes Youth Icon Award at the Forbes Leading Women Summit in South Africa. Her impassioned speech about her electric car venture, Kemetive Automotive, and poised stage presence drew widespread acclaim, with many noting her resemblance to her mother, Bose Ogulu.
